Costs


The California Public Utilities Commission regulates the rates of California American Water. The CPUC will review, consider and take action on the rate impacts of the Coastal Water Project through the Certificate of Public Convenience and Necessity (CPCN) application process, which is held concurrently with the CPUC’s environmental review.
